The City of Starkville held a work session focused on several key community development and infrastructure projects. Highlights included the upcoming groundbreaking for the Main Street project, updates on absentee voting and election preparations, and a detailed presentation on the Parks Proximity Project, which analyzed park service areas and demographics to guide future park development and amenities. The board discussed entering an agreement with Innovative Rail Partners LLC to explore acquiring a rail corridor for trail development, emphasizing potential economic and community benefits without immediate financial commitment. Additionally, the meeting covered various consent approvals for contracts and projects, including water and sewer system bonds, airport hangar construction, ADA symposium attendance, emergency road repairs, stormwater improvements, sidewalk hazard removal, and utility infrastructure upgrades. Challenges such as sourcing American-made pump components were also highlighted, reflecting broader supply chain issues impacting project timelines and costs. Overall, the session underscored the city's proactive approach to infrastructure, community amenities, and strategic partnerships to enhance public services and quality of life.
